思潮课程 / 数据库 / 正文

电商数据库,电商数据库概述

2025-01-21数据库 阅读 1

电商数据库是一个用于存储和办理电商渠道上一切数据的体系。它一般包括以下信息:

产品信息: 包括产品称号、描绘、价格、库存、图片等。 订单信息: 包括订单号、客户信息、产品信息、数量、价格、付出方法、订单状况等。 客户信息: 包括客户名字、联系方法、地址、购买前史等。 买卖信息: 包括买卖号、买卖时刻、买卖金额、付出方法等。 谈论信息: 包括谈论内容、评分、谈论时刻等。

电商数据库一般运用联系型数据库办理体系 来存储和办理数据。常用的 RDBMS 包括 MySQL、Oracle 和 SQL Server 等。

除了存储和办理数据外,电商数据库还能够用于以下意图:

数据剖析和陈述: 能够剖析出售数据、客户行为数据等,以了解事务状况并做出更好的决议计划。 个性化引荐: 能够依据客户的购买前史和阅读行为,向他们引荐相关的产品。 库存办理: 能够实时盯梢库存状况,并及时弥补库存。 客户服务: 能够快速查询客户订单信息,并为客户供给更好的服务。

总归,电商数据库是电商渠道的柱石,关于电商事务的运营和开展至关重要。

电商数据库概述

跟着电子商务的快速开展,电商数据库作为支撑整个电商事务的中心,其重要性显而易见。电商数据库不只需求存储很多的产品信息、用户数据、订单信息等,还需求具有高效的数据查询、处理和剖析才能。本文将环绕电商数据库的规划、优化和最佳实践进行讨论。

电商数据库规划准则

1. 数据一致性准则

电商数据库规划应保证数据的一致性,防止呈现数据冗余、不一致等问题。经过合理规划数据表结构、运用外键束缚、触发器等手法,保证数据的一致性。

2. 数据完整性准则

数据完整性是指数据在逻辑上正确、有用。在电商数据库规划中,应考虑数据类型、长度、束缚等,保证数据的完整性。

3. 数据安全性准则

电商数据库触及很多用户隐私信息,因而数据安全性至关重要。应选用加密、拜访操控、审计等手法,保证数据安全。

4. 数据可扩展性准则

跟着电商事务的不断开展,数据库需求具有杰出的可扩展性。在规划数据库时,应考虑未来事务需求,预留满足的扩展空间。

电商数据库表结构规划

1. 产品信息表

产品信息表存储产品的基本信息,如产品ID、称号、价格、库存等。该表一般包括以下字段:

产品ID(主键)

产品称号

产品价格

库存数量

产品描绘

产品分类

产品图片

2. 用户信息表

用户信息表存储用户的基本信息,如用户ID、名字、暗码、邮箱等。该表一般包括以下字段:

用户ID(主键)

用户名字

暗码

邮箱

手机号

注册时刻

3. 订单信息表

订单信息表存储订单的基本信息,如订单ID、用户ID、产品ID、订单金额、订单状况等。该表一般包括以下字段:

订单ID(主键)

用户ID

产品ID

订单金额

订单状况

下单时刻

付出时刻

电商数据库优化战略

1. 索引优化

合理规划索引能够明显进步查询功率。在电商数据库中,应针对常用查询字段创立索引,如产品称号、价格、分类等。

2. 分区优化

关于大型数据表,能够考虑分区优化。将数据依照时刻、区域、产品分类等进行分区,进步查询功率。

3. 缓存优化

使用缓存技能,如Redis、Memcached等,能够削减数据库拜访次数,进步体系功能。

4. 读写别离

选用读写别离技能,将查询操作和更新操作分配到不同的数据库服务器,进步体系并发处理才能。

电商数据库最佳实践

1. 数据库规范化规划

遵从数据库规范化规划准则,防止数据冗余和更新反常。

2. 数据库安全战略

施行数据库安全战略,如拜访操控、数据加密、审计等,保证数据安全。

3. 数据库备份与康复

定时进行数据库备份,保证数据安全。一起,拟定合理的康复战略,以应对数据丢掉或损坏的状况。

4. 数据库监控与优化

实时监控数据库功能,发现并处理潜在问题。定时对数据库进行优化,进步体系功能。

电商数据库是电商事务的中心,其规划、优化和最佳实践对电商渠道的安稳运转至关重要。本文从电商数据库规划准则、表结构规划、优化战略和最佳实践等方面进行了讨论,旨在为电商数据库的规划与优化供给参阅。

猜你喜欢

  • 数据库导出excel,sql数据库导出excel句子数据库

    数据库导出excel,sql数据库导出excel句子

    要将数据库中的数据导出到Excel文件,一般需求遵从以下进程:1.衔接数据库:首要,需求运用相应的数据库衔接库(如Python中的`sqlite3`、`pymysql`、`psycopg2`等)来衔接到数据库。2.查询数据:运用SQL查...

    2025-01-21 0
  • 大数据单位,新时代的数字力气数据库

    大数据单位,新时代的数字力气

    1.字节(Byte):是核算机存储数据的基本单位,一般用B表明。1字节等于8位(bit)。2.千字节(Kilobyte):简写为KB,等于1024字节。3.兆字节(Megabyte):简写为MB,等于1024千字...

    2025-01-21 0
  • 数据库束缚有哪些,什么是数据库束缚数据库

    数据库束缚有哪些,什么是数据库束缚

    1.主键束缚(PrimaryKeyConstraint):保证表中的每一行都有仅有的标识符。一个表只能有一个主键。主键列不能包括NULL值。2.外键束缚(ForeignKeyConstraint):...

    2025-01-21 0
  • 大数据基金,金融科技与出资理念的完美交融数据库

    大数据基金,金融科技与出资理念的完美交融

    1.出资战略大数据基金首要选用“量化模型大数据”的出资战略。具体来说,这些基金经过剖析消费者行为大数据,与其他因子一同构建模型,拟定出资战略。量化出资的成功关键在于模型的质量、数据的质量以及战略的有用履行。2.商场体现现在商场上总...

    2025-01-21 0
  • 大数据岗位要求,大数据岗位概述数据库

    大数据岗位要求,大数据岗位概述

    1.大数据剖析师:教育布景:一般需求统计学、数学、计算机科学等相关专业的学士学位或更高学位。技能才能:娴熟把握数据剖析东西,如Excel、SQL、R、Python等;了解数据发掘、机器学习等数据剖析办法;具有杰出的数据可视...

    2025-01-21 0
  • 数据库脏读,什么是数据库脏读?数据库

    数据库脏读,什么是数据库脏读?

    脏读(DirtyRead)是数据库并发操控中的一种现象,它指的是一个业务读取了另一个未提交业务的数据。这意味着在业务A读取数据后,业务B对同一数据进行修正,而且业务B的修正没有提交,此刻业务A再次读取同一数据,就或许读到业务B修正后的数据...

    2025-01-21 0
  • 北京大数据训练组织哪家好,北京大数据训练组织哪家好?全方位解析与引荐数据库

    北京大数据训练组织哪家好,北京大数据训练组织哪家好?全方位解析与引荐

    北京大数据训练组织哪家好?全方位解析与引荐跟着大数据年代的到来,把握大数据技能已成为很多求职者和职场人士的寻求。北京作为我国科技立异中心,具有很多优异的大数据训练组织。本文将为您全面解析北京大数据训练组织,协助您找到适宜自己的学习渠道。一、...

    2025-01-21 0
  • mysql权限办理,MySQL 权限办理概述数据库

    mysql权限办理,MySQL 权限办理概述

    MySQL权限办理是数据库安全性的一个重要方面,它答应数据库办理员操控用户对数据库的拜访。以下是关于MySQL权限办理的一些根本概念和操作:1.用户办理:创立用户:运用`CREATEUSER`句子来创立新用户。...

    2025-01-21 0